The Vernal Tithing Office is a historic building in Vernal, Utah. It was built in 1887 by Harley Mowery as a tithing building for the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ints. It is a gable-front building with some elements of Greek Revival architectural style.[2] It has been listed on the National Register of Historic Places since January 25, 1985.[1]
